Abstract
The objective of this paper is to present the current situation of the National Vertical Geodetic Network of Mexico including operation indicators, data, precision, digital file availability, condition of the National Mareographic System, elevation values referred to the mean sea level, its correlation with values referred to NAVD88 and its application in the digital geographic data production. Finally, the projects for the linkage of the network to a datum correlated with the reference framework associated to the ellipsoid GRS80 and the geoid determination in Mexico are mentioned.
